HOW DO WE KEEP THE SABBATH?

WHAT DOES GOD'S 4TH COMMANDMENT SAY?

EXODUS 20:8-11
[8], Remember the SABBATH DAY, to KEEP IT HOLY. <Why?> Because God made it Holy for mankind and commands us to keep it as a Holy day)
[9], Six days shalt thou labor, and do all thy work:
[10], But the SEVENTH DAY IS THE SABBATH of the LORD thy God: in it thou shalt not do any work, thou, nor thy son, nor thy daughter, thy manservant, nor thy maidservant, nor thy cattle, nor thy stranger that is within thy gates: <WHY>
[11], For in six days the LORD made heaven and earth, the sea, and all that in them is, and rested the SEVENTH DAY: wherefore the LORD BLESSED THE SABBATH, and HALLOWED IT.

WHAT DAY IS GOD'S SABBATH?

v10 The SEVENTH DAY of the week. (Saturday)

WHEN DOES THE SEVENTH DAY OF THE WEEK START?

GENESIS 1:4-5
[4], And God saw the light, that it was good: and God divided the light from the darkness.
[5], And God called the light Day, and the darkness he called Night. And the evening and the morning were the first day.

A day in God's time is the night (darkness) and the light make up one day. The DAY in God's WORD starts at SUNSET and ends the following SUNSET. So God's 4th Commandment Sabbath would start Friday at SUNSET and end Saturday at SUNSET.

ALL UNECCESSARY WORK TO BE DONE BEFORE FRIDAY SUNSET

EXODUS 16:22-23
[22], And it came to pass, that on the sixth day they gathered twice as much bread, two omers for one man: and all the rulers of the congregation came and told Moses.
[23], And he said to them, This is that which the LORD has said, To morrow is the rest of the holy sabbath to the LORD: bake that which you will bake to day, and seethe that you will seethe; and that which remains over lay up for you to be kept until the morning.

MARK 15:42, And now when the even was come, because it was the preparation, that is, the day before the sabbath

The preparation day is the 6th day of the week. This includes preparing to stop all business and secular work as well as any domestic work; cooking, cleaning; shopping, buying and selling that can be done on any other day of the week.

IT IS LAWFUL TO DO GOOD ON THE SABBATH?

MATTHEW 12:5-12
[5], Or have you not read in the law, how that on the sabbath days the priests in the temple profane the sabbath, and are blameless?
[6], But I say to you, That in this place is one greater than the temple.
[7], But if you had known what this means, I will have mercy, and not sacrifice, you would not have condemned the guiltless.
[8], For the Son of man is Lord even of the sabbath day
[9], And when he was departed from there, he went into their synagogue:
[10], And, behold, there was a man who had his hand withered. And they asked him, saying, Is it lawful to heal on the sabbath days? that they might accuse him.
[11], And he said unto them, What man shall there be among you, that shall have one sheep, and if it fall into a pit on the sabbath day, will he not lay hold on it, and lift it out?
[12], How much then is a man better than a sheep? Therefore it is lawful to do well on the sabbath days.

MARK 2:27, And he said unto them, The sabbath was made for man, and not man for the sabbath

It is lawful to do good on the Sabbath.

WHAT IS LAWFUL ON GOD'S SABBATH?

1. Remembering the creator and his creation (Exod 20:8-11)
2. Rest from all unnecessary work (Ecodus 20:10-11)
3. Doing good (Matt 12:12)
4. Prayer (Acts 16:13; Matt 21:13)
5. Worship the creator (Isaiah 58:13-14; Exodus 34:14; 1KING 9:6; Revelation 14:6-12)

Song, praise, bible study, helping others, preaching the gospel, resting, prayer, seeking God, remembering the creator and his creation. Walking in nature, going to church with like minded believers. (too many scriptures)

WHAT IS NOT LAWFUL ON GOD'S SABBATH?

WORK; all business and secular work as well as any domestic work; cooking, cleaning; shopping, buying and selling that can be done on any other day of the week and anything to do with work (Exodus 20:8-11; Exodus 16:22-23; Matthew 21:13).

Hi.

The Sabbath is Saturday, but the Lord's Day (the day of the Resurrection) is Sunday. The two are not synonymous.

On the Sabbath, we should avoid non-essential work if possible. Someone in the medical field is generally exempt from this rule, as are gas station attendants, etc. If society won't break down without you, you should rest if you can (though you're free to go shopping and such if you desire- "rest" can also mean recreation, so do what is enjoyable to you).

Alternatively, it's a great act of charity to help those who need rest the most on the Sabbath. Volunteering at a food pantry, soup kitchen, etc. are great ways to grant rest to those who need it.

Ultimately, the Sabbath is a symbol of the eternal rest we can gain in Heaven, and we should try to live the Sabbath out as holy as we can.

Notice that the Sabbath is Saturday - in Acts 13 we see both Jews and gentiles in the synagogue on the Sabbath. So also in Acts 17:1-5 and in Acts 18:1-5. It is very clear that Bible writers affirm that the day the Jews were meeting in the Synagogues in the NT is the Bible Sabbath. So then -- Saturday.

Jesus was resurrected "on the first day of the week" so even Sunday keepers agree that the first day is Sunday making the 7th day Saturday - the Sabbath.

In Exodus 16 God says "tomorrow is the Sabbath" -- telling Moses the very day in their real life that is the Sabbath.

In Ex 20:10 we read "the seventh day is the Sabbath of the LORD (YHWH)"
In Ex 20:11 and in Gen 2:1-3 we see that it began for mankind in Eden as the 7th day of creation week.
In Mark 2:27 as you point out it was "MADE for mankind". it is a blessing for mankind not just Jews.
In Isaiah 66:23 "from Sabbath to Sabbath shall ALL MANKIND come before Me to worship" for all eternity after the cross in the NEW earth when all MANKIND that is left is only the saved not the lost.

In Isaiah 56:6-8 we see gentiles specifically singled out for Sabbath keeping.

In Lev 23:1-3 we see that the 7th day Sabbath is a day of "sacred assembly" of "Holy convocation".

In Isaiah 58:13 we see that it is not a day where one can engage in secular activity.

And of course Christ reminds us it is also a day for helping/healing the sick and preaching the Gospel.
